Woman facing possible charges after pouring bleach on ex's doorway

By Kyle Feldscher

A 35-year-old Ypsilanti Township woman may need to clean up her act after pouring bleach on the doorway of her ex-boyfriend when she heard he was living with another woman.

Ypsilanti police reported the 34-year-old man told his ex-girlfriend he was living with a new roommate, who is a woman. The news so infuriated the ex that she drove to the home in the 600 block of Washtenaw Avenue to confront him.

When she arrived, the woman shoved the man and poured bleach in the doorway, according to police. She then left the scene prior to police showing up at the house.

Police responded to the home at 4:13 a.m. Tuesday.

According to investigators, the case was turned over to the Washtenaw County Prosecutor’s Office on Wednesday for potential charges.

Investigators also said they don't know why bleach was the woman's weapon of choice.
